01 · Positioning

We do not sell inventory. We sell the feeling of finding value.

People do not need to arrive knowing the exact car they want. AutoPlus earns attention by making every visit feel like a new opportunity: something arrived, a hidden gem appeared, Taggy found a smarter answer.

The single-minded idea
Come see what Taggy found.

Most automotive pages say, “Here is a car.” AutoPlus creates a reason to return—even before a customer is actively shopping.

The cast

Five characters. One clear role each.

This hierarchy prevents every post from becoming a salesman talking at camera. The customer carries the emotion; the car resolves it; Taggy connects the two.

01 · THE GUIDE

Taggy

The spirit of AutoPlus. Notices, reacts, points, reveals and approves—without speaking.

02 · THE HERO

Customer

The person with the real-life problem, desire, budget or moment that gives the story meaning.

03 · THE SOLUTION

Car

Not a sheet of specifications. The practical or emotional answer revealed at the right moment.

04 · THE HELPERS

Sales team

Warm human support. They clarify and assist; they never overpower the story.

05 · THE WORLD

AutoPlus

The outlet where changing arrivals, useful finds and customer stories keep happening.

02 · Character Bible

Taggy is not a mascot. Taggy is the guide.

Taggy behaves like a silent character from visual comedy: instantly understandable, slightly unexpected and always one step ahead of the problem.

Silent · visual · useful
Taggy, the AutoPlus brand character, standing confidently

Taggy never

  • Talks or receives dialogue
  • Acts like a salesperson or employee
  • Announces offers himself
  • Explains specifications
  • Becomes noisy, childish or random

Taggy can

  • Hold signs and point
  • React, approve or reject
  • Hide and appear unexpectedly
  • Guide customers toward a reveal
  • Solve the scene through action
Performance references

Elizabeth, Gintama: silent signs and readable action. Mr. Bean: physical comedy, universal problems and visual problem-solving. Borrow the grammar—not the character.

The formula

Seven beats keep short-form content clear.

Not every post needs the same timing, but the logic should remain visible: a human problem earns attention, Taggy changes the scene, and the car becomes the answer.

01

Hook

A visual or line understood in the first two seconds.

02

Problem

A real tension: budget, family, choice, timing or status.

03

Taggy

He appears, reacts, redirects or reveals.

04

Solution

The problem becomes simpler or funnier.

05

Car reveal

The vehicle arrives as the right answer.

06

Offer

Only the approved, current commercial detail.

07

CTA

One next action: comment, DM, browse or visit.

08 · Measurement

Measure the job each pillar is meant to do.

A funny Taggy film should not be judged only by leads; a product post should not be judged only by reach. Use the KPI family that matches the content's role.

Attention

Taggy + culture

  • 3-second hold rate
  • Average watch time
  • Shares and non-follower reach
Interest

Outlet + real life

  • Saves and profile visits
  • Comments asking “how much?”
  • Inventory clicks and DMs
Confidence

Product + proof

  • Completion rate
  • WhatsApp or call taps
  • Test-drive enquiries
Commercial

Monthly account

  • Qualified enquiries
  • Store visits attributed to social
  • Units sold from tracked leads
